Exploring Ohio Medicaid Laws and Regulations

Ohio Medicaid offers a valuable safety net for eligible residents, providing crucial healthcare coverage. However, successfully accessing and maintaining these benefits requires a firm grasp of the complex legal framework and regulations that govern the program. Applicants applying for Medicaid in Ohio must familiarize themselves with key provisions such as eligibility criteria, enrollment procedures, benefit coverage limitations, and provider networks. The Ohio Department of Medicaid provides a wealth of information to support applicants and recipients in navigating this system.

A thorough study of the Medicaid handbook and other official publications is essential. Furthermore, it is strongly advised to seek guidance from legal professionals or advocacy organizations specializing in attorneys licensed in ohio Medicaid law for clarification on specific cases. By actively engaging information and understanding their rights, Ohio residents can maximize their access to the critical healthcare benefits provided by the Medicaid program.

Crafting Compelling Arguments for Ohio Medicaid Eligibility

Securing approval for Ohio Medicaid can sometimes prove a obstacle. To maximize your chances of being accepted, it's essential to develop compelling arguments that clearly demonstrate your necessity for coverage.

A strong case should include all applicable details about your monetary situation, physical condition, and any special circumstances that may warrant Medicaid assistance. Provide detailed examples to demonstrate your vulnerability to afford healthcare on your own.

Remember to offer your information in a structured and respectful manner, following all instructions outlined by the Ohio Medicaid program.
